This is referring to this article: [url=http://www.sqlteam.com/item.asp?ItemID=8866]Hierarchy Article[/url].

I'm having a problem ordering the items if they have the same lineage - since the order by orders by the node ID, is there a way to order by another field if they are in the same lineage?
